Why it was recalled
There is potential for the images to be flipped left to right.
Root cause (FDA determination)
Device Design
Action the firm took
This issue will be resolved by sending an Urgent Medical Device Correction letter to customers with affected systems. This 2/18/2022 letter informs the customer of the issue and provides actions to be taken for the continued use of the device. GE Healthcare will provide a revised service manual that includes a required Finalization step that ensures a geometry check with a DQA phantom (or similar) following Gradient Switch servicing to ensure cable placement is correct and will have no impact on image orientation. A second letter was send to customers on 07/27/2022 and included instructions and link for customer to access and download the revised service manual.
